City councilor Tania Fernandes Anderson to plead guilty Monday to federal public corruption charges

She made history four years ago with her election to the Boston City Council, but Tania Fernandes Anderson’s tenure on that body could come to an ignominious end Monday.

By pleading guilty, Fernandes Anderson could face a significantly reduced sentence. Prison terms for wire fraud can run up to 20 years. Prosecutors will ask for one year and one day in prison — as well as restitution of $13,000.

That is the same amount in public funds Fernandes Anderson is accused of awarding as a bonus to a relative working in her city council office — with the understanding that $7,000 would come back to Fernandes Anderson to pay an ethics fine.

That ethics fine, $5,000, was imposed on Fernandes Anderson in 2023 as a penalty for hiring two immediate family members to her city council staff. She was also required to terminate their employment. That was in August 2022.

A few months later, the Department of Justice alleged that Fernandes Anderson informed the city of a new hire — with an assurance that person was not related to her.

The charging documents refer to that new hire as Staff Member A — and describe that person as a relative of Fernandes Anderson, but not an immediate family member. Staff Member A is the person who received the $13,000 in early May 2023. By June 9, the DOJ alleged Staff Member A had paid $7,000 in cash to Fernandes Anderson.

A federal grand jury indicted Fernandes Anderson last December. Calls for her resignation have been growing since then. In early April, she agreed to the plea deal and said she would resign.
